The First Edition of the fully electric Mustang Mach-E by Ford Motor Company is officially sold out. Despite not delivering until the end of 2020, the company received 50,000 deposits in the last five weeks of 2019. Other models such as the Premium edition and the GT are still available for pre-order.

Here are some data points from Ford’s reservations bank:

  • Carbonized Gray is the most popular choice at 38%; Grabber Blue Metallic is second at 35% and Rapid Red third at 27%
  • More than 80% of U.S. customers are reserving the Mach-E with a 98.8 kWh Extended Range Battery that will charge at a rate up to 150 kW and is targeted to deliver a 270 mile range
  • About 55% are opting for all-wheel drive featuring peak power of 248 kW/332 HP and peak torque of 417 lb.-ft.
  • Almost 30% of U.S. customers are choosing the Mach-E GT, expected to arrive in the spring of 2021 and targeting 0 to 60 in the mid three second range!
  • More than a quarter of all reservations are coming from California
